はい、可能です。ただし、出力用に別のテーブルを用意しておく必要があります。
次のような入出金管理アプリを例に説明します。
テーブルへの記入は入出金テーブルに行いますが、Excel出力するときには、出金だけをまとめたページ、入金だけをまとめたページに分けて出力するとします。
kintoneアプリ構成
kintoneアプリに入出金テーブルを入金のみ、出金のみに分けて出力するためのテーブルを作成します。
テーブルへの書き出しは、レコードを保存するたびに行います。
レコード保存のときに、出力用テーブルに書き出すカスタマイズ
「レコードを保存する直前(削除時は除く) 」に入出金テーブルから入金のみのテーブル、出金のみのテーブルへ書き出すカスタマイズです。
まず、「テーブル行をレコードとして取得する 」で入出金テーブルのテーブル行をレコードとして取得します。
「取得したレコードを絞り込む」を使って「分類」が「入金」のものだけを絞り込み、「レコードをテーブルに書き出す」でテーブルに書き出します。保存のたびに最新化したいので、「既存のテーブル行はクリアする」としておきます。
同じように、「分類」が「出金」のものも別のテーブルに書き出します。
Excelテンプレート例
Excelテンプレートでは、入金テーブルと出金テーブルを使います。
テンプレート1(入金のみのテーブル)
テンプレート2(出金のみのテーブル)
このテンプレートでは、一覧画面から複数レコードを対象に出力することを想定しています。
Excel出力のカスタマイズ
ボタンを押したときに「一覧の条件でレコードを全件取得する 」で取得したレコードを対象に「Excelを出力する」を行っています。
出力結果
テンプレート1(入金のみのテーブル)の結果
テンプレート2(出金のみのテーブル)の結果
まとめ
このように、出力用のテーブルを作成しておけば、必要な行のみ抜き出した出力が可能です。
実際に作成してみられてご不明な点などございましたら、お気軽にチャットでご質問ください。